10 Effective Strategies to Skyrocket Your Email List

Building an email list is like nurturing a garden. With the right care and strategies, it can flourish and yield abundant results. In the digital age, your email list is a powerful asset for reaching your audience, promoting your business, and driving conversions. Here, we’ll explore ten highly effective strategies to help your email list thrive and grow.

1. Offer Valuable Content

Content is king in the online world. Create high-quality blog posts, e-books, whitepapers, and resources that resonate with your target audience. At the end of each piece of content, include a compelling call-to-action (CTA) that encourages readers to subscribe to your email list. Provide something of value in exchange for their email address.

2. Harness the Power of Social Media

Social media platforms are goldmines for promoting your content and connecting with potential subscribers. Share your blog posts, e-books, and other valuable resources on your social media channels. Use persuasive CTAs to invite your followers to join your email list and stay updated.

3. Host Engaging Webinars

Webinars are an excellent way to interact with your target audience directly. Choose topics related to your business or industry and provide valuable insights. At the end of each webinar, invite attendees to subscribe to your email list for more valuable content and updates.

4. Run Exciting Contests

Contests are a fun way to engage your audience and entice them to join your email list. Offer prizes that align with your business or products, and require participants to provide their email addresses for entry. Ensure that your contest rules are clear and abide by relevant regulations.

5. Utilize Thoughtful Pop-Ups

Pop-up forms can be effective when used tactfully. Use them to offer discounts, free resources, or exclusive content in exchange for email subscriptions. Customize the pop-ups to appear at the right time and place on your website without disrupting the user experience.

6. Create Irresistible Landing Pages

Landing pages are tailored to convert visitors into subscribers. Craft a landing page that highlights the benefits of joining your email list and includes a clear and compelling CTA. Make the sign-up process easy and straightforward.

7. Network at Events

Attending industry events, conferences, and trade shows is an excellent opportunity to connect with potential subscribers. Collect email addresses from people you meet, and after the event, send them personalized follow-up emails inviting them to join your email list.

8. Offer Compelling Lead Magnets

Lead magnets are free resources that you offer in exchange for an email address. Create valuable lead magnets such as e-books, checklists, templates, or guides, and promote them on your website and social media channels. Ensure that the lead magnets are relevant to your audience’s interests.

9. Optimize Your Website for Conversions

Your website should be optimized to convert visitors into subscribers. Include CTAs strategically throughout your site, inviting visitors to join your email list. Make the sign-up process user-friendly and minimize friction.

10. Leverage Paid Advertising

Paid advertising can help you reach a broader audience. Utilize platforms like Facebook ads or Google AdWords to promote your lead magnets and landing pages. Collect email addresses from those who sign up through these campaigns.

3. How can I maintain a clean email list?

Maintaining a clean email list is essential for effective email marketing:

  • Remove Inactive Subscribers: Regularly identify and remove subscribers who haven’t engaged with your emails for an extended period.
  • Address Bounce Rates: Deal with email addresses that consistently bounce, as they can harm your sender reputation.
  • Respect Unsubscribe Requests: Honor unsubscribe requests promptly to maintain trust with your subscribers.
  • Eliminate Duplicate Entries: Regularly check for and remove duplicate email addresses to keep your list accurate.
  • Update Your List: Continually add new subscribers while removing outdated or irrelevant addresses.

4. Why is email list segmentation important?

Email list segmentation involves dividing your email list into smaller, targeted groups based on specific criteria. It is essential because:

  • Personalization: Segmentation allows you to send personalized content that resonates with each group, increasing engagement and conversions.
  • Higher Open Rates: Segmented campaigns consistently achieve higher open rates compared to non-segmented ones.
  • Increased Click-Through Rates (CTR): Targeted messages lead to higher CTR, as recipients find the content more relevant.
  • Better Conversion Rates: Segmentation enhances the likelihood of converting subscribers into customers.
  • Reduced Unsubscribe Rates: Subscribers are less likely to opt out when they receive content tailored to their preferences.

5. How can I measure the success of my email marketing efforts?

You can measure the success of your email marketing campaigns through various metrics:

  • Open Rate: The percentage of recipients who opened your email.
  • Click-Through Rate (CTR): The percentage of recipients who clicked on a link within your email.
  • Conversion Rate: The percentage of recipients who completed a desired action, such as making a purchase.
  • List Growth Rate: The rate at which your email list is expanding.
  • Bounce Rate: The percentage of emails that were not delivered successfully.
  • Churn Rate: The rate at which subscribers unsubscribe or become inactive.
  • Spam Complaint Rate: The percentage of recipients who marked your email as spam.

These metrics provide insights into the effectiveness of your campaigns and help you refine your email marketing strategy.
